PARAQUITA BAY, Tortola, VI- Little princesses and fairies in tutus and pointe shoes pranced, glided, spun and performed arabesques, among other dance moves, much to the delight of a ‘full house’ at Eileene L. Parsons Auditorium at H. Lavity Stoutt Community College (HLSCC) in Paraquita Bay, Tortola, where local dance group Nouveau Royale presented a 22-item dance treat on July 6, 2019.

Nouveau Royale is a dance group founded by twin sisters Lakiesha R. Claxton and Natisha T. Claxton, who Virgin Islands News Online have both featured as Young Professionals in the past, and presented an opportunity for the dancers of the group to showcase their talent to parents, other relatives and friends.

The dance recital was held under the theme: ‘Our Dance Dictionary: A Royal Festival of Nations’, and saw most of the items taking a modern ballet style of dance.

Highlights

Some 40 dancers performed on the evening and the items included guest performances by the BVI Dance School, Diva Sensation and Tune House and also featured mother-daughter and father-daughter dances.

The dances were to music both classical and contemporary, as well as of the reggae, pop and soca genre.

One of the highlights of the evening was a dance under the theme ‘Four Seasons With a twist’, performed by the Junior and Elite dance groups as well as the BVI Dance School. The dance featured a kaleidoscope of colours and a varied pace and mood to symbolise the different seasons.

One of the dances, ‘Bird Set Free’ was inspired by the movie, ‘Birdbox’, while another was titled ‘Irma’ which sought to depict the strength and resolve of the Virgin Islands following the devastation of Hurricane Irma.

The camera shy Directors/Founders/ Choreographers of Nouveau Royale, Lakiesha and Natisha, were commended for their work with the young dancers of the group and encouraged to continue their good work. Some parents also pooled resources to present the ‘twins’ with a gift basket as a token of appreciation.

Lakiesha noted that working with the dancers demands a lot of work and time but they are passionate about what they do and persevered.

She said it took a tremendous amount of work to get the show pulled off successfully and was especially grateful to parents of the dancers from her group as well as the sponsors.
